After months of speculation, it’s now official: the iconic Monica Quartermaine, a character on the canvas for nearly 50 years, has passed away. Co-head writers Elizabeth Korte and Chris Van Etten shared with TV Insider that the news will devastate the Quartermaine family, hitting Jason and Tracy particularly hard.
But as the Quartermaines prepare for a “grand goodbye” to their matriarch, a new chapter is about to begin. Slezak, known for her powerful role as Victoria Lord on ‘One Life to Live,’ is stepping into Port Charles with a purpose. The writers expressed their excitement about securing such a powerhouse talent, saying she will “challenge the status quo” and make waves across the entire cast.
The biggest twist, however, lies in her character’s arrival. Slezak’s mysterious new character will make her debut at Monica’s memorial, bringing with her a surprising connection to the Quartermaine clan and other characters in town. While the writers kept the specifics under wraps, a report from Daytime Confidential has revealed an unprecedented secret that will rewrite the show’s history: Slezak is rumored to be playing Monica’s sister.
This detail is a game-changer for fans, as Monica was always established as an orphan with no direct family ties. The introduction of a secret sibling after all these years adds a layer of depth and drama that only ‘General Hospital’ can deliver.
